Output c34b65cdec4955be14334f45230c38b89dab8d32a9e347d1d06be00032fdcea2:0

value
18496009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62cfc41d620675723eccceef3dc796e5b0eb84a OP_EQUAL
address
MTRcj7xrMDC2VGXeCKJZAij1vWT1b28tiA
transaction
c34b65cdec4955be14334f45230c38b89dab8d32a9e347d1d06be00032fdcea2
spent
true